Portrait of Russian lawyer Sergei Magnitsky, who paid a high price for exposing corruption in Russia. He died in November 2009 under dubious circumstances in a detention center in Moscow, while awaiting trial. His death caused outrage internationally, but in Russia it remains silent. The Wall Street Journal describes Magnitsky's death as a "slow murder." The Moscow Public Oversight Committee calls it "a murder to cover up fraud." Under public pressure, President Dmitry Medvedev opens an investigation, but a year later no one has been held responsible for the murder. In Justice for Sergei, Magnitsky's family, friends and former colleagues tell for the first time on camera about the man who fought for justice from childhood, even during his wrongful incarceration. And how this man dared to take on the all-destroying corruption in his country, which proved fatal to him.
